DEVELOPMENT OF A TOPICAL R126521 FORMULATION WITH IN VITRO SKIN PERMEATION AND RELEASE STUDIES

摘要

In vitro release tests are efficient tools to investigate the influence of excipients and solvents on the release of active compounds from a formulation. The skin accumulation of R126521 from conventional and investigational topical formulations was very low. The incorporation of PEG 400 or HPβCD in formulations improved the release of the formulation, but not the in vitro skin accumulation. Therefore, it can be concluded that the limiting factor in R126521 skin penetration is the skin barrier function, and not its availability from the formulation. The penetration enhancers limonene, oleic acid and linolenic acid significantly increased the skin accumulation and permeation of R126521. Currently, formulations of R126521 with these penetration enhancers are being developed.
